Output 66da3508d37863401eefedfb593bdca11c98321ad4db8f467c853ef3b9c2373c:3
- value
- 28397
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cdb88e4dbddad7fba883333431520eef34ecc91
- address
- tb1q8ndc3exmmkkhlw5gxve5x9fqame5any3l56ueh
- transaction
- 66da3508d37863401eefedfb593bdca11c98321ad4db8f467c853ef3b9c2373c